I want to remove the body moldings / side skirts off my AE92

Posted Image

They have no discernible screw holes apart from the wheel arches. I was just gonna use the heat gun and pry them off.

Anyone have tips on how to go about it to minimise paint damage?

As stated previously, remove the bolts holding them on.

Most of the cases, there is sikaflex. Best way to remove them is to use a heat torch or a hair dryer to heat the sikaflex which aids in removal. when you have removed the side skirts, there will be residual sikaflex on the car. grease and wax remover will do the job removing that.
